“Do You Want A Puppy?”

The ABC News bureau in Baghdad has adopted a puppy from the Fox News bureau. Appropriately enough, the staff named him Fox.

The opportunity arose at a barbeque sponsored by Fox News. “Towards the end of the party, the Fox News bureau chief says, ‘so do you want a puppy?,’” ABC Baghdad bureau chief Clark Bentson blogs.

The garden in ABC’s bureau has been overrun by cats. “So, ‘do you want a puppy?’ became a way to in my mind to keep the cats out of the garden and a way to give us a little extra security,” Bentson says.

A few days later, “the pup still is a little shell-shocked, but cute as hell. He doesn’t know what to think of people (and we think he may have been abused by the locals before FOX NEWS adopted his family). He spends 22 hours a day under my desk, but won’t come near me. I feed him three times a day, pick him up to take him out to do his thing (yes there have been accidents); and yesterday he chewed through a computer internet cable when I wasn’t looking.” More…
